How do you verify someone actually graduated from a University? (Arizona State Univ.) Are there lists?

April 172010

I am suspicious that this person is lying to me about graduating from Arizona State University. Does anyone know if alumni lists are available online or how I could know for sure?

When I worked in credentialing, we had to have the permission of someone (the person we are requesting the information on) before requesting verification of their degree. Most schools now use studentclearinghouse.com or something along those lines (and for a fee). There are some, however, where you can verify the information right over the phone by contacting the school’s registrar’s office.

how do i deny admission to the university of arizona?

April 122010

recently i was accepted into the university of arizona. now after already being accepted into my first choice how do i tell arizona that im not interested. other colleges that ive been accepted to have given me the choice to accept or deny admission but arizona doesnt.

Send a postal letter thanking them for admission and telling them that you have decided to attend another university. Do not name the other university. Be sure your name, address, U of A ID number, if any, and the date of the letter are on the letter. Sign the letter. Keep a photocopy of it. Mail the original to U of A.

Whats the lowest gpa Northern Arizona University will let in?

April 62010

My friend is looking into applying there with me and she wants to know if she could get in. I hear they have a good teaching program there and that’s what she wants to do. She has a 2.7 gpa, so what are the chances of her getting in?

I found the admissions requirements on Northern Arizona University’s website. She still has a chance of getting in. From the web page:

"Arizona residents may be conditionally offered admission if they meet the following:

* 2.5-2.99 GPA* (on a 4.0 scale), or
* top 50 percent class rank
* and have no more than one deficiency in any two subjects in the course requirements. Students with a combination math/science deficiency are not admissible. Conditionally admitted students may be required to participate in academic assistance programs."

"Nonresident students may be conditionally offered admission based on individual circumstances and/or space availability if they meet the following:

* 2.50-2.99 GPA* (on a 4.0 scale), or
* top 50 percent class rank
* and have no more than one deficiency in any two subjects in course requirements. Students with a combination math/science deficiency are not admissible. Conditionally admitted students may be required to participate in academic assistance programs."
